Tesco Express in Botley could be getting a new cashpoint.
A planning application to install a new ATM in the Tesco Express in Elms Court, Botley has been made.
The plans for the new ATM show a light and CCTV camera will be installed for security reasons and it will be located near the entrance of the supermarket.

In the design and access statement,Tesco architecture planning manager, Andy Horwood explained the installation of the cash machine will be completed under controlled safe conditions and will have a minimal impact on customers.
The consultation period started on March 25 and it will end on April 17 while the target decision date is May 14.
